Best Email Encryption Software

 

Best Secure Email Services

There are a number of secure webmail providers. Many of them use end-to-end encryption which makes the encrypted communications more secure. These secure emails may prove to be a good option if you want to send encrypted message to someone.

 

1. ProtonMail

Features :

  • ProtonMail uses end-to-end encryption. As a result, only the sender and recipient of the encrypted email can read it. Even the service provider does not have access to the secret keys using which the emails are encrypted.
  • One can set emails to expire after certain length of time after which the email will become unreadable.
  • ProtonMail uses PGP to encrypt messages.
  • It does not support IMAP and POP.
  • It is easy to use.
Price : ProtonMail is an Open Source software. The basic version is free. But, one can upgrade to paid plans for better features. Paid plans vary from 4 euro per month to 30 euro per month.

 

2. Hushmail

Features :

  • Using Hushmail one can send encrypted emails to both Hushmail users and non-users.
  • If the recipient is a Hushmail user, the email will be automatically encrypted and sent.
  • If the recipient is not a Hushmail user, the sender can select a security question.
  • The recipient will get a link in his inbox on clicking on which the recipient has to provide a secret passphrase. The user can use the same secret passphrase to read all encrypted messages sent by Hushmail. A first time user has to create a passphrase.
  • On providing passphrase, the recipient will be asked to answer the security question set by the sender of the encrypted email following which he can read the email.
  • Hushmail supports POP and IMAP.
  • It also supports 2 Factor Authentication for better security.
  • It includes a spam filter.
  • One can also enable auto-responder.

3. Tutanota

Features :

  • Tutanota is an Open Source Software under GPL License.
  • It uses end-to-end encryption to send encrypted messages.
  • One can send encrypted messages to Tutanota users as well as non-users.
  • If a sender is sending an encrypted message to a Tutanota non-user, the sender would need to specify a password at the time of encryption and provide the password to the recipient using some different channel.
  • The recipient would need to provide the password to decrypt and read the encrypted message.

5. Mailfence

Features :

  • Mailfence uses end-to-end encryption for encrypting emails.
  • It is inter-oparable with any OpenPGP service.
  • It provides the option of digitally signing an email, which can guarantee that only the authorized user has sent the email.
  • It supports Web, POPS, IMAPS, SMTPS and mobile accesses.
  • It also supports 2 Factor Authentication for better security.

6. Countermail

Features :

  • It uses diskless web server to prevent IP-addresses leaking to a hard drive. Even if someone hacks the web server, they will not be able to get valuable private information like IP addresses.
  • When a sender wants to send an encrypted message, he has to encrypt the message using OpenPGP public key of the recipient, so that the recipient can decrypt the message using her private key and read it.
  • Countermail provides USB Key option.
  • It is compatible with Android phone.
  • It supports password manager.
  • One can use one’s own domain name with Countermail.
